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39983727 4410 62
45 7102783
45 7102783
01693 66086065 4037 91032859
All about undefined
Interested in learning more?
45 7102783
01693 66086065 4037 91032859
See more
026309 294017576
67901366846 10 97937034430
See more
048 4424
79 65961 59 58
See more